Othonoi

The Diapontia Islands are a complex of islands in the Ionian Sea located at the northwestern end of Corfu and including Ereikoussa, Mathraki, Othonoi as well as some smaller inhabited islets.

Othonoi
The biggest island of the complex, Othonoi, is the westernmost part of Greece. It has a wonderful natural environment comprising the ruins of Venetian castles, traditional houses and old churches. Ammos is the port of Othonoi.

Sightseeing
From Ammos you can take a boat, reach the green-water beach and see the cave where, according to legend, the nymph Calypso held Odysseus captive.
Also visit the rock-islets of Kastrino and Ostrako, and the enchanting settlements of Dafni and Chorio.

Activities
• Swimming at Ammos, Aspri Ammos and Fyki.
• Sailing

How to get there
The Diapontia Islands are accessible by boat from Sidari and Arila in Corfu.
